What is Workers’ Compensation?

Workers Compensation is a form of insurance plan that employers contribute in order to protect against accidents or injuries that occur on the job. Employers with three or more employees are required to contribute to workers’ compensation within Georgia.

The law governing workers’ compensation gives injured workers with access to rehabilitation services, medical assistance as well as income-related benefits in the event of an injury during their work. The benefits allow injured workers to return to their places of work. They also can be used when an employee died as a result of injuries.

What does Workers’ Compensation Involve?

Workers’ compensation benefits comprise the following:

  • Any kind of repetitive stress injury like tendonitis, could result from inadequate ergonomics in the workplace job.
  • In cases when an employee injured has to undergo treatment for long periods of time.
  • All wages that are not paid, in the past and in the future, in order to let employees rest and recover from their injuries. This kind of benefit expires when the employee is back at their work.
  • Permanent and temporary disability benefits in the event of a workplace injury that causes the impairment.
  • Funeral costs and death benefits in the event that an employee dies as an outcome of the workplace incident. In Georgia the death benefits are provided to the dependents with two-thirds of the weekly average wage of the deceased.

What Do I Need to File a Claim?

In Georgia, The State Board for Workers’ Compensation is responsible for all claims for workers’ compensation. Anyone who is injured can contact or write to this board to make a claim. After the claim is filed the board will look over the claim, ask for additional details if necessary and then make an official decision in the claim.
